
Inland was proud to host the Link-Belt Log Loader Operator Competition at the Williams Lake Harvest Fair on September 6th and 7th, a community event that brought together skilled operators, local businesses, and enthusiastic crowds for a great cause.
The competition was a highlight of the fair, where operators skillfully maneuvered the powerful Link-Belt 3240B Timber Loader to stack logs with speed and precision. The fierce competition was matched by a strong spirit of sportsmanship, creating a memorable experience for everyone involved.
More importantly, the event raised a total of $3,350 for the Cariboo Memorial Hospital Foundation, supporting vital healthcare services in the region.
Inland extends a massive congratulations to the finalists and winners:
- 1st Place: Ryan Tugnum – Progressive Harvesting Ltd. – Williams Lake, BC
- 2nd Place: Lee Dwinnell – Timber Service Ltd. – Quesnel, BC
- 3rd Place: Shaun Tenhunen – Northern Raven Holdings – Mackenzie, BC
- 4th Place: Kurt Baraniuk – Ambrus Logging Ltd – Prince George, BC
- 5th Place: Justin Graham – Jordco Enterprises – Williams Lake, BC
- 6th Place: Laura McCabe – Bid Right Contracting Ltd. – Prince George, BC
